From the presence of polymorphonuclear (PMNs) leucocytes, LTB4 can indirectly bring about hyperalgesia in all probability with the afferent terminal pathway [19]. LTB4 can cause sensitization in the nociceptors by escalating the cAMP/PKA things to do. Some animal experiments have speculated that the accumulation of inflammation-induced neutrophil is very connected with the rising quantity of LTB4, which triggers the indirect stimulation of hyperalgesia.

One of the characteristic Qualities of nociceptors is their capacity to result in sensitization, which happens to be the potential to improve neuronal excitability. Sensitization is usually a course of action that includes a reduction in the threshold of activation, along with an increase in the reaction rate to damaging stimulation. It usually effects from tissue insult and inflammation [22]. Furthermore, stimuli that do not create an influence right before the process of sensitization usually takes put may perhaps subsequently turn into efficient and produce spontaneous exercise soon after sensitization takes place [23].

In this article we uncovered that extended-expression injection of morphine in mice leads to the morphine metabolite M3G accumulation, which activates ERK1/two by means of APLNR and finally activates the release of microglia and inflammatory elements TNF-α, IL-1β, and IL-17, exacerbating NCP. These conclusions incorporate to our comprehension of the purpose of APLNR in pain and highlight the crucial mechanisms of morphine tolerance. We also found that M3G binds on the MOR and activates ERK1/2, in addition to activating ERK1/2 via APLNR. Morphine has two metabolites: M3G and morphine-six-glucuronide (M6G). M6G binds for the opioid receptors and exerts analgesic results. M3G has low affinity for opioid receptors and will be involved with the development of morphine tolerance 38. Experiments showed that M3G can activate ERK1/2 and microglial proliferation to some extent. In comparison with this, the effect of M3G binding and acting with APLNR is much more clear; consequently, it may be hypothesized that in morphine tolerance, M3G may act extra via APLNR and only marginally or through MOR to some extent.

The involvement of H4 receptors in each acute (Galeotti, Sanna, & Ghelardini, 2013) and persistent inflammatory pain (Hsieh et al., 2010) is relatively perfectly documented, and lately, the position of H4 receptors inside the modulation of neuropathic pain was determined in H4 receptor‐KO mice throughout the observation that these animals, when subjected to neuropathic pain, induced by spared nerve damage of sciatic nerve, showed Improved hypersensitivity to mechanical and thermal stimuli compared to wild‐form controls (Sanna, Ghelardini, et al., 2017). Apparently, H4 receptor deficiency isn't going to assistance a task for H4 receptors from the physiological upkeep of pain threshold, as H4 receptor‐KO mice didn't show any modify in thermal or mechanical nociceptive thresholds, suggesting the H4 receptor is specially involved with the regulation of hypersensitivity affiliated with pathological chronic pain induced by nerve personal injury (Sanna, Ghelardini, et al., 2017). This observation in H4 receptor‐KO neuropathic mice is particularly critical as H4 receptor mRNA expression in human beings and rodents supports their involvement in the regulation of neuronal purpose, such as regulation of neuropathic pain.
